Dante Biagioni

Dante Biagioni was an Italian actor best known for his roles in The World Is Not Enough (1999), Kung Fu Panda (2008), and Castigo (1977). He was born on January 9, 1935, in Pistoia, Tuscany, Italy, and passed away on August 3, 2016, in Rome, Lazio, Italy.
